它赋予了用户前所未有的控制权,允许他们以最直接的方式与操作系统进行交互
然而,正如双刃剑一般,这份力量也伴随着巨大的风险
本文将深入探讨一个极具破坏性的命令——“rm -rf /linux”(尽管实际中更常见且更危险的是“rm -rf /”),分析其潜在危害,并探讨如何防范此类灾难性操作的发生
一、命令解析:何为“rm -rf” 首先,让我们分解这个命令:“rm”是Linux中用于删除文件或目录的命令,全称为“remove”;“-r”或“--recursive”选项表示递归删除,即不仅删除目标文件或目录本身,还删除其内部的所有子文件和子目录;“-f”或“--force”选项则意味着强制执行,不会询问确认,也不会因为找不到文件或目录而报错
当“rm -rf”后面跟随的是一个根目录或系统关键目录的路径时,其后果将是灾难性的
理论上,“/linux”并非一个标准的Linux系统目录(标准目录如“/bin”、“/etc”、“/home”等),但若将此命令中的“/linux”理解为泛指系统中的一个重要目录,甚至是误写为“/”(根目录),其影响将不堪设想
二、潜在危害:从数据丢失到系统崩溃 1.数据不可逆损失:一旦执行“rm -rf /linux”(假设错误地指向了关键数据目录),该目录下的所有文件、配置、日志乃至应用程序都将被无情删除
对于个人用户而言,这意味着珍贵的照片、文档、项目文件可能永远无法找回;对于企业而言,则可能导致客户数据、业务记录等重要信息的永久丢失
2.系统关键功能失效:如果误删了系统关键目录,如“/bin”(存放可执行文件)、“/lib”(存放库文件)、“/etc”(存放配置文件)等,系统的基础功能将受到严重破坏
系统可能无法启动,或启动后缺少必要的程序和服务,导致无法正常使用
3.安全风险增加:系统关键文件的缺失还可能使系统更容易受到攻击
例如,安全配置文件的丢失可能使防火墙规则失效,从而让系统暴露在潜在的网络威胁之下
4.恢复成本高昂:即使技术高超的IT专家介入,试图从物理硬盘中恢复被删除的数据或重建系统,这一过程不仅耗时费力,而且成本高昂
对于某些类型
Linux etc/localtime:时区设置全解析
掌握rm - linux命令的安全指南
揭秘词根hyper:超越极限的含义
Hyper技术:快速识别优盘新体验
Linux串口查询技巧大揭秘
架,每种方法都有其独特的优势和适用场景。重要的是,开发者应根据具体项目的需求、技
超速下载!Hyper XP软件获取指南
Linux etc/localtime:时区设置全解析
Linux恶搞脚本:让你的系统充满趣味与惊喜的创意代码
Linux串口查询技巧大揭秘
Linux变量教程:掌握编程基础
一键重置Linux界面,轻松焕新系统体验
揭秘Linux高手如何巧妙接手私活,实现技术变现之路
Linux平台下调用WCF服务实战
Linux Deploy配置清华源教程
Linux下轻松联机Windows技巧揭秘
Linux Secyrecrt 64位:安全新高度解析
大厂必备:精通Linux编程技巧
Linux防火墙设置全攻略:轻松构建安全防线